Chapter 1

I kept hearing a beeping sound.

When I opened my eyes, the lights were way too bright so I put my hand over my eyes.

I heard a sweet woman’s voice, “Hey, sweetheart, you’re awake! Let me dim the lights a little for you.”

The voice sounded so familiar, but I couldn’t place it.

I slowly opened my eyes and found an older couple sitting on either side of the bed.

I remembered seeing both of these people at my last birthday party, “Grandma?” I asked then turned to the man, “Grandpa?”

They both nodded.

Grandma asked, “How are you feeling, sweetheart?”

“Thirsty. The rogues killed mommy and daddy. Didn’t they?” I croaked. I knew they were dead, I just needed to hear it from someone else.

As soon as I saw the worried look on each of their faces, I knew they were dead.

My grandmother poured a cup of water for me and put a straw in it while my grandfather kissed my forehead.

Their hands were warm and comforting.

As I was drinking, I was informed by grandpa that they had made arrangements for me to live with them. He asked if I would be okay with it.

I nodded as I asked, “Do you have pictures of them? I want to get the blood out of my brain.”

I then looked down and saw a lot of bandages, “It really hurts. Can I sit up?”

Grandma was wiping the tears from her eyes when grandpa nodded, “We do have pictures of them. Let’s wait until the nurse gets in here before you try to sit up. I am so sorry you had to see that little one. We will see what we can do to replace that bad memory.”

I remember the doctor walking into my room and looking at my wounds. He told me it was good to see me awake and alive and they were worried about me. I asked him a few questions and he answered them in terms that I could understand. I thanked him and he left.

Only a few minutes later, I heard more footsteps.

As I was wondering who they could be, I saw the alpha, luna of our pack. They were followed by a cute little boy. He had light brown hair, adorable caramel eyes and a cute button nose.

looked to be around my age, but he walked like he already knew exactly who he was and how important he was to the pack.

That boy immediately walked to my bedside and stood beside me, staring into my eyes.

Somehow, I saw sincerity and warmth in his eyes.

As I watched him, I smiled at him. He smiled back, “I’m Isaac, the future alpha.”

I felt an instant connection as I answered, “I’m Zariah. It’s nice to meet you.”

He introduced his parents to me and I nodded in respect at them. They seemed like nice people.

Looking at me, Luna Kyra asked me how I was feeling.

Isaac startled everyone when he scowled at his mother, “She is in a lot of pain, mother, can’t you see? You guys should go home. I want to sit here with her! I can protect her!”

I suddenly felt the atmosphere in the room shift to an uncomfortable awkward.

I immediately figured out why. Alpha and Luna are busy. They took time out of their busy schedules to visit me.

Alpha Kenny got his attention and explained, “Isaac, we have other things that you need to do. Let Zariah get better and you can sit with her at her grandparents’ home. Okay?”

Isaac sighed as he put his hand on mine, “I’m sorry, Zariah. I wish I could stay with you.”

I laid my other hand on his and answered, “It’s okay. I would like for you to visit when I go home.”

Alpha Kenny chuckled at the sweet sight, “He can come over whenever your grandparents let him.”

My grandmother chuckled, “I’m sure they will be best of friends.”

After a short visit, they left.

I stared at the ceiling thinking of the warmth in Isaac’s hand and the sincerity in his eyes.

The nurse came back and put something in my IV.

When I woke up from a hard sleep, I found my grandfather sitting next to me.

I asked, “Grandpa, have you been home at all since I got here?”

He chuckled, “It’s okay, sweetie. I don’t want you to be alone at all. Your grandmother is at home, taking a nap. She also wanted to make some cookies for when you get to come home.”

Soon after, I was taken for some tests.

When I was brought back to my room, I saw the doctor was sitting with my grandpa, “Well, Zariah, it looks like you can go home. I will send some medicine with your grandpa and I want you to lay still and get plenty of rest.”

I agreed. Grandpa helped me get dressed, and the nurse brought in my medicine. After briefly speaking with my grandpa, I was carried to the car and was taken to their house… my new home.

When we got there, I opened the door to my room and found that they had gone to my old house and picked up everything in my room, plus some of my parents’ things to hold on to for me when I grew up. 

My grandma walked into my room and sat on my bed, “Do you like your room?”

I nodded, “I do.”

She hugged me, “Child, I would do anything for you. You deserve the world.”

I kissed her cheek and laid on my bed as I yawned, “I think I need to take a nap. I’m really sleepy.”

Grandma smiled, “You go ahead and go to sleep, child. We’ll be here when you wake.”

After grandma left, I found myself not so tough at all.

I put my teddy bear up to my face and I could still smell my mom’s scent on it.

I smelled one of my pillows and could still smell my dad’s scent on it.

I laid my teddy bear beside me on the bed and tears filled my eyes.
